Special Needs Assistance

We all benefit when children with special needs are given what they need to become as successful in their community as their abilities allow. No parent should have to choose between seeing their child thrive and putting gas in the tank or food on the table. The current health insurance structure is forcing families of children with special needs to decide between paying for effective, evidence-based speech, occupational, physical and other therapies and services or paying their household bills. Multiple co-pays, high deductibles, limited insurance benefits and lack of coverage provide barriers to care. The weight of realizing that your child's future isn't affordable is a tremendous burden to bear. This is why we were founded. We provide funding for access to the resources and support that these families desperately need.
